Compartilhar via


Estilos de controle de calendário de mês

As constantes de estilo a seguir são usadas ao criar controles de calendário de mês.

Constante Descrição
MCS_DAYSTATE
Versão 4.70. O calendário do mês envia MCN_GETDAYSTATE notificações para solicitar informações sobre quais dias devem ser exibidos em negrito.
MCS_MULTISELECT
Versão 4.70. O calendário do mês permite que o usuário selecione um intervalo de datas dentro do controle . Por padrão, o intervalo máximo é de uma semana. Você pode alterar o intervalo máximo que pode ser selecionado usando a mensagem MCM_SETMAXSELCOUNT .
MCS_WEEKNUMBERS
Versão 4.70. O controle de calendário do mês exibe números de semana (1-52) à esquerda de cada linha de dias. A semana 1 é definida como a primeira semana que contém pelo menos quatro dias.
MCS_NOTODAYCIRCLE
Versão 4.70. O controle de calendário do mês não circula a data "hoje".
MCS_NOTODAY
Versão 4.70. O controle de calendário do mês não exibe a data "hoje" na parte inferior do controle.
MCS_NOTRAILINGDATES
Windows Vista. As datas dos meses anteriores e seguintes não são exibidas no calendário do mês atual.
MCS_SHORTDAYSOFWEEK
Windows Vista. Nomes de dia curto são exibidos no cabeçalho .
MCS_NOSELCHANGEONNAV
Windows Vista. A seleção não é alterada quando o usuário navega próximo ou anterior no calendário. Isso permite que o usuário selecione um intervalo maior do que está visível.

Requisitos

Requisito Valor
parâmetro
CommCtrl.h